CNC Engineering is a provider in the integration of the latest in manufacturing technologies. The company offers services in the areas of machine rebuilds, rotary tables, and additional axis, as well as tool monitoring and adaptive control systems. On display will be samples of Vision Systems, Cell Systems, and Robot Pick & Place Solutions, along withh an Auto Coupler system for palletized rotary tables in a linear pallet pool. Experienced personnel will also be available to discuss the latest release of TMAC (Tool Monitoring Adaptive Control).
